When you call for an air duct cleaning estimate, the final cost depends on a few practical details about your home. The biggest factors are the total number of vents and registers connected to your system, along with the square footage of your property. If your home has multiple HVAC units or complicated ductwork layouts that are harder to access, that may influence the time required for the job. We also look at whether you need additional sanitization or dryer vent cleaning services.

Signs your air ducts in Austin may need cleaning include excessive dust settling on surfaces shortly after cleaning, recurring allergy or asthma symptoms, musty or unpleasant odors when your heating or cooling system is operating, and a noticeable decline in your HVAC system's efficiency. These are clear indicators your ducts are harboring contaminants.

You should consider having your air ducts cleaned if you notice excessive dust settling quickly after cleaning, if you or your family experience persistent allergy or asthma symptoms indoors, or if you detect strange odors when your heating or cooling system is running. Visible mold or debris within the ducts is also a clear sign that professional cleaning is needed.
